
Keith Attwood
Keith was CEO of e2v technologies plc, a global electronics company, from 1998 to 2013 having previously worked at a senior level within the telecommunications, defence and aerospace sectors. Keith led a management buy-out of e2v in 2002, listing the Company on the LSE in 2004 and delivering a return of 3 X to 3i. e2v was acquired by a US corporate for £600m+.
A former Chair of the CBI’s Employment and Skills Board and on the Advisory Board for Essex Police and Crime Commission, Keith is currently a Governor/Chair at Anglia Ruskin University (c£200m T/O).
As an advisor and active direct investor, Keith has been engaged on a range of consultancy projects with Private Equity; pre-acquisition due diligence, turnaround and buy and build. He has directly invested in a number of younger companies operating in the digital, fintech/banking, bio pharma and renewables sectors. Where appropriate, Keith provides C Level mentoring and support to management in those businesses.
